Output e68bf43b427432351a037655c838baef3050e2cbec7b4ed251874824afa7b092:0

value
25085297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c89a942bb53717e9734b5bb8d88ed380a13d7b OP_EQUAL
address
328JwWUo2r2stxtiedVRw3LK6s5SzRUyxs
transaction
e68bf43b427432351a037655c838baef3050e2cbec7b4ed251874824afa7b092
spent
true